linux命令怎么查看进程

fiy 其他 65

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要查看进程的相关信息,可以使用以下几个常用的 Linux 命令:

    1. `ps`
    – `ps` 命令用于查看当前运行中的进程。
    – 基本用法:`ps aux`,该命令会列出所有的进程信息,包括进程 ID(PID)、CPU 使用率、内存使用情况等。
    – 也可以根据需要使用不同的选项来过滤进程信息,例如 `ps -ef`、`ps aux –sort=-%cpu` 等。

    2. `top`
    – `top` 命令可以实时动态地显示正在运行的进程和系统性能。
    – 基本用法:直接输入 `top` 命令,会实时显示进程的信息,包括 CPU 使用率、内存占用、进程列表等。
    – 可以使用不同的选项来排序进程列表,例如按 CPU 使用率排序:`top -o %CPU`。

    3. `htop`
    – `htop` 是一个更加强大的进程查看工具,相比于 `top`,它提供了更多的交互功能和显示选项。
    – 可以通过包管理工具安装 `htop`,例如 `apt-get install htop`。
    – 使用 `htop` 命令启动后,会显示类似于 `top` 的进程列表,但是界面更加友好和直观,功能更丰富。

    4. `pgrep` 和 `pkill`
    – `pgrep` 命令用于根据进程名称查找进程 ID,`pkill` 命令用于根据进程名称结束进程。
    – 基本用法:`pgrep <进程名称>`,例如 `pgrep nginx` 将返回所有包含 “nginx” 的进程的 ID。
    – 使用 `pkill` 命令可以通过进程名或进程 ID 结束指定的进程,例如 `pkill nginx` 结束所有名为 “nginx” 的进程。

    总结:以上是常用的几个 Linux 命令,可以帮助你查看进程信息。根据不同的需求,选择合适的命令来查看进程,以及进行进程管理和监控。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要查看Linux系统中的进程,可以使用以下命令:

    1. `ps`命令:用于显示当前正在运行的进程的信息。可以通过不同的选项来过滤和格式化输出。常用的选项包括:
    – `-e`或`-A`:显示所有进程。
    – `-f`:显示完整的进程信息,包括进程的父进程ID(PPID)和进程的命令行参数。
    – `-u`<用户>:显示特定用户的进程。
    – `-C`<命令>:显示特定命令的进程。
    – `-p`<进程ID>:显示特定进程ID的进程。

    示例:`ps -ef`命令将显示所有进程的完整信息。

    2. `top`命令:实时显示系统中运行的进程和系统的整体性能。可以通过交互式界面来查看进程的详细信息,如进程ID、CPU使用率、内存占用等。使用`top`命令可以按照不同的排序方式来显示进程列表,例如按CPU使用率、内存占用等排序。

    3. `htop`命令:类似于`top`命令,但提供了更多的功能和交互式界面。`htop`命令允许您使用键盘来交互,并提供了更多的排序和过滤选项。

    4. `pgrep`命令:用于通过进程名称或其他属性查找进程ID。可以与其他命令结合使用,如`kill`命令来终止进程。

    示例:`pgrep sshd`命令将显示所有名称为`sshd`的进程ID。

    5. `pstree`命令:以树状图显示系统中的进程和它们的关系。通过`pstree`命令可以更好地理解进程之间的层次结构和关联性。

    这些命令可以帮助您快速查看系统中运行的进程,并提供详细的进程信息。根据自己的需求,选择合适的命令来查看您感兴趣的进程。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ux系统中可以使用一些命令来查看当前正在运行的进程。常用的命令包括:

    1. ps命令:ps命令用于查看进程的状态信息。在终端中输入”ps”命令即可列出当前用户的所有进程。常用的选项包括:

    – `ps -aux`:列出所有进程的详细信息,包括其他用户的进程。
    – `ps -ef`:列出所有进程的详细信息,包括进程的树形结构。

    2. top命令:top命令可以动态地显示系统的进程状态,包括CPU占用率、内存占用率等。在终端中输入”top”命令即可启动top命令。

    3. htop命令:htop是一款交互式的进程查看器,功能比top更强大。可以通过终端中输入”htop”命令来启动。

    4. pstree命令:pstree命令可以以树形结构显示进程,可以清楚地看到进程之间的关系。可以通过终端输入”pstree”命令来查看树形结构。

    5. pgrep命令:pgrep命令用于根据进程名称查找进程的PID。例如,使用`pgrep firefox`命令可以查找到所有名称为firefox的进程的PID。

    6. pidof命令:pidof命令也是根据进程名称查找进程的PID,使用方法与pgrep类似。

    7. pmap命令:pmap命令用于显示进程的内存映射信息,可以查看进程的内存占用情况。

    以上是常用的几个命令来查看进程信息的方法,在使用时可以根据具体需求选择合适的命令。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部